Kibogaoka Hill (キボウヶ丘 Kibogaoka?, lit. Hope Hill) is a location in Jet Set Radio Future.

Overview[]

Taking inspiration from the Kibogaoka section from Kogane-cho, this area has the same feel as Rokkaku-dai Heights but is in a favela style of house placing. Similar to places like Dogenzaka Hill and Highway Zero, it is structured somewhat like loop with the starting point and ending point being the same location. It is one of the hardest areas to do Street Challenges in, as its lumpy rough ground makes it hard to move around without the use of telephone wires. There are also multiple locations that can lead to the player falling into water and thus losing health. Kibogaoka Hill can only be accessed via the Tokyo Underground Sewage Facility.

Story[]

During the story, the GG's come to Kibogaoka Hill to spray over the Immortals' graffiti in chapter 4. The Rokkaku Police will also show up using helicopters as a way to stop the GG's. Clutch may also appear here when the player must re-obtain the Graffiti Souls he took from them in chapter 7, if found on time he will reveal Yoyo's actual location of captivity. Also in the chapter the Golden Rhinos will make an appearance to stop the GG's with automatic weapons.

Mystery Tape[]

The Mystery Tape can be found in the area with two large sets of power lines, pick the left side and choose the bottom-most line to a platform. The tape will be right in front of the player.

Graffiti Souls[]

Kibogaoka Hill, like most locations, holds home to eight collectable Graffiti Souls. Three pre-spawned ones, and five unlockable ones that only appear after completing the Street Challenges for the area.

Pre-spawned[]

  • Located under a tower before the tunnel like area. (No. 019)
  • On the ledge past the area where Boogie spawns. (No. 047)
  • On a platform past the gate for the special challenge. (No. 132)

Street challenges[]

  • Grind Combo x20: Located deep inside the pit near a metal tower. (No. 076)
  • Air Combo x4: Look for a pit with a phone pole sticking out to find this soul. (No. 105)
  • 50 Tricks: Located in a pit right before the tunnel. (No. 133)
  • 250,000: points Head into the tunnel with the green lighting and go down a ladder and look for a hidden path in the wall (No. 021)
  • Gate of (kanji): Right after the area Boogie spawns in, look for a pit and follow it. A boost dash will be needed to get this soul. (No. 049)

Trivia[]

  • Kibogaoka means "Hope Hill", so the literal translation of the name is "Hope Hill Hill".
  • There are lots of stray animals in this area and there is even a large concrete room just full of cats and a beaten-up sofa, which has springs and stuffing pop out when touched.
  • Oddly enough, a launchpad for firing multi-stage rockets into space can be seen not far at all from a nearby town square, a gross and universal violation of both noise, zoning and safety laws. The player also passes through a large chamber housing multiple silos containing small rockets that bear a variant of the Rokkaku Group logo. Considering that these rockets are much too small to launch satellites into orbit, they may be a very disturbing sign that the Rokkaku Group possesses intercontinental ballistic missiles and the means to fire them.
